Structure of the ternary complex of the IMPDH enzyme from Ashbya gossypii bound to the dinucleoside polyphosphate Ap5G and GDP Descriptor: ACETATE ION, GUANOSINE-5'-DIPHOSPHATE, Inosine-5'-monophosphate dehydrogenase, ... Authors: Buey, R.M, Fernandez-Justel, D, Revuelta, J.L. Deposit date: 2019-05-14 Release date: 2019-08-28 Last modified: 2024-01-24 Method: X-RAY DIFFRACTION (2.11 Å) Cite: The Bateman domain of IMP dehydrogenase is a binding target for dinucleoside polyphosphates. J.Biol.Chem., 294, 2019
